This year, there are two parts to my March Madness resource for you to enjoy! Part 1 is the traditional resource I have always made available to you. It includes all of the bracket directions, voting forms, and some questions to use with each book. It is the same great resource you know and love! Part 2 is the comprehension companion that is designed for you to provide students with response space to answer some questions and prompts that will extend their learning of the topic and/or allow for independent research or design!
